Organizational Challenge - Week 1
 
Ok - I have spent quite some time looking through the gallery at all the 'scrap spaces' pictures that have been posted there.

Some of you wonderfully talented people are so organized! I am very envious!! So, I decided to give myself a kick in the butt, and while at it, challenge all you other SCS out there as well!

So, once a week, I will post a Organizational Challenge.

Some will be quick and easy, some not so quick and easy! Some you may of allready done, others you might of been putting off!

So to start the challenge off, you have 4 assignments!

1 - take a 'before' picture - posting it is up to you, but it will help keep you motivated.

2 - take out the garbage can - you know, the overflowing garbage can that leads to garbage on your desk, floor, and where ever else it lands in the creative process. Dont worry about the rest of the garbage elsewhere - that is for next week!

3 - Make a list of your organizational goals. Please try to post your goals here - it might help some with this.

4 - REMOVE any NON-STAMPING and NON-SCRAPPING related items from your craft space!

That overflowing garbage can doesn't happen to me - thankfully! What I do is put a plastic grocery bag on the peg (back) of my chair (or next to me) and just use that for whatever I'm working on. Then, when I'm done with a project and cleaning up, I just put all my tiny scraps, etc. in there and throw the whole thing away! Feels much better to me to actually throw it out - as kind of the final thing for that project - than to see a full trash can sitting there. You may try that and see if it works for you? :wink:

If you are lucky enough to be moving into a fresh, clean, empty room soon (as some of you are) START ORGANIZED!! This means, as painful as it may be, dont take it out of the box until you have a 'home' for it!!!

I tried to do that - worked for a few things - I waited to unpack all my 12x12 paper until I had a way to store it other than on a pile on the floor! Now, I not only know what I have, but I no longer think to myself "I know I have the perfect paper in this stack here, but it is easier for me to drive the 2 min to the store to buy a sheet then to try and find it in that pile"

Charmed 03-28-2005 04:07 PM

You first have to open them in a photo editor program of some kind on your computer. Then you will need to 'save as' so you save a copy to your computer - I have a sub folder in 'my documents' called 'my cards' the is is where I save all my SCS cards to upload.

Anyways, once you have a copy saved to your computer, you make any modifications you want - crop out your thumb or whatever. Then, you will want to resize the image - how you do this will depend on the software you are using. Then, save your changes, and upload as you normally would to SCS.
